Community Impact (CI), in partnership with neighborhood partners, strives to advance the public good, by providing quality social services, food assistance, youth mentoring, tutoring, and adult education in the Morningside Heights, Harlem, and Washington Heights communities.

CI provides classes in English for Speakers of Other Languages (ESOL), High School Equivalency (HSE) preparation for adults ages 18 and above. We incorporate job readiness and college preparation into its General Education Development (GED) curriculum. The goal of the program is to help adults improve their English language proficiency, enhance literacy and numeracy skills, obtain high school equivalency diplomas, transition to advanced training, and obtain or improve employment.
